We Do Not Have A Music Industry In Nigeria – 9ice by Hitboy7(m): 7:07am On May 19, 2017
Veteran singer 9ice, believes the country does not have a music industry.

During his bit on Funmi Iyanda’s show ”ASK FUNMI EPISTLE” the Living Things crooner, was asked what he thinks about where the music industry is at now and 9ice replied saying the country does not have an industry, instead it is packed full of talented people, who come together to make things happen with their resources.

The singer, also talked about his reason for singing in Nigeria, adding that his decision to sticking with the Yoruba language for his music, is partly to prove people wrong that he can make it doing this and also to make his people proud.
